How do you feel about taking on repetitive tasks In Wildlife Conservation Society?
Submitted by: AdministratorThis answer depends on whether or not the job has a lot of repetitive tasks with no variation. If it does, then you would need to be okay with the idea of doing the same task over and over again. If you feel you can offer more than repetitive work, then describe how you would be able to do so.
